HT42B532-x
USB to I 2C Bridge IC
Features
• Operating Voltage (VDD): 3.3V~5.5V
• I2C pins Voltage (VDDIO): 1.8V~VDD (Less than VDD
voltage)
• Fully integrated internal 12MHz oscillator with
0.25% accuracy for all USB modes which requires
no external components
• USB interface
♦♦ USB 2.0 Full Speed compatible
♦♦ Implements USB protocol composite device:
–– Communication Device Class (CDC) for
communications and configuration.
–– Human Interface Device (HID) for user
configure USB VID, PID and device
description strings
♦♦ Integrated an internal 1.5kΩ pull-high resistor on
D+ pin
• Serial Interface – I2C
♦♦ Supports clock rate up to 400kHz
♦♦ Supports Master and Slave modes decided by AP
command
♦♦ Supports maximum 62 bytes transmit buffer and
62 bytes receive buffer
♦♦ Supports SDA (Master mode) and SCL or SDA
(Slave mode) pins resume signal to request a
remote wake-up
♦♦ Supports VDDIO pin for I2C and A0~A1 pins
power supply
• Support standard Windows® drivers for Virtual
Com Port (VCP): Windows XP (SP2), Vista,
Windows 7, Windows 8, Windows 8.1 (only an
INF file is required) and Windows 10.
• Support Android 4.0 or later version and Mac OS
X
• Integrated 256 bytes internal true EEPROM for
user memory
• Power down and wake-up functions to reduce
power consumption
• Package types: 8-pin SOP, 10-pin MSOP
General Description
The HT42B532-x is a high performance USB to I2C
bridge controller with fully integrated USB and I2C
interface functions, designed for applications that
communicate with various types of I2C. The device
includes a USB 2.0 full speed compatible interface
which is used for PC commication. The device also
includes a fully integrated high speed oscillator which
is used for USB and I2C clock generator.
USB Bridge IC Naming Rules
Product Family
HT42B 5 3 2 - x
HT42B = Holtek Bridge IC
Bridge Series of Host
5 = USB
USB Class type
3 = CDC Class
6 = HID Class
Version
1 = First Version
Bridge Series of Device
2 = I2C
3 = SPI
4 = UART
